Freda Markley Early Childhood serves 190 students in grades Prekindergarten.
The student-teacher ratio of 13:1 is higher than the Missouri state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 89%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Missouri state average of 33% (majority Black and Hispanic).

Freda Markley Early Childhood's student population of 190 students has declined by 15% over five school years.
The teacher population of 15 teachers has declined by 6% over five school years.
